ISO 28706-2:2017 specifies a test method for the determination of the resistance of flat surfaces of vitreous and porcelain enamels to boiling acids, boiling neutral liquids, alkaline liquids and/or their vapours. This method allows the determination of the resistance of vitreous and porcelain enamels to the liquid and vapour phases of the corrosive medium simultaneously.

Overview
ISO 28706-2:2017 specifies a standardized test method to determine the resistance of flat surfaces of vitreous and porcelain enamels to chemical corrosion by boiling media. The method covers exposure to boiling acids, boiling neutral liquids, alkaline liquids and/or their vapours, and allows simultaneous assessment of attack by both the liquid and vapour phases of the corrosive medium. This second edition extends the scope to include alkaline liquids and a standard detergent solution.
Key topics and technical requirements
- Scope and specimen: Applies to flat enamel surfaces; describes required test specimens and preparation.
- Test principle: Simulates corrosion by boiling solutions and/or condensate vapour to evaluate enamel dissolution and surface degradation.
- Reagents and test solutions: Includes boiling citric acid, sulfuric acid, hydrochloric acid, distilled/demineralized water, standard detergent, and provisions for other solutions/conditions.
- Apparatus and packing: Details test apparatus, materials and packing ring types (Packing A and B) to control liquid/vapour exposure.
- Procedure: Specifies exposure conditions (temperature, duration, solution composition) and handling to ensure reproducible results.
- Expression of results: Results are reported as total loss in mass per unit area (g/m²) for tests that show logarithmic behavior, and as rate of loss in mass per unit area (g/m²·h) and corrosion rate (mm/year) where attack proceeds linearly (for example, azeotropic boiling acids).
- Corrosion behavior considerations: Discusses how enamel composition, temperature, pH and silica solubility influence attack; explains inhibition effects in liquid-phase testing and why vapour-phase condensate can give uninhibited attack.
Practical applications and users
This standard is valuable for:
- Enamel manufacturers and quality-control laboratories assessing product durability.
- Coating and materials engineers specifying enamel systems for corrosive environments.
- Corrosion testing laboratories performing standardized comparative tests.
- Procurement and compliance teams who require accredited test data for specification and acceptance. Typical application areas include sanitaryware, cookware and appliances, chemical process equipment and other products where vitreous/porcelain enamel is used to provide corrosion resistance and inert surfaces.
